Q: Can you recommend an all-weather tire for a Toyota Sienna?
Need the best performing all-weather tire for a 2004 Toyota Sienna. Live in cold climate with some snow.

A: As far as I know, there are only 2 true all-weather/all-season tires on the market. These have both the severe weather snow-tire emblem (snowflake on mountain symbol) on the sidewall, and they also have a full UTAQ rating/treadwear warranty. Nokian WR All-Weather Plus (A.W.P): http://nokiantires.com/tyre?id=11884&group=1.01&name=Nokian+WR Nokian WR G2: http://nokiantires.com/tyre?id=11899&group=1.01&name=Nokian%20WRG2 Otherwise, you'd be looking for a more traditional mis-named "all-season" tire (really 3-season tire), preferrably with the M+S (mud and snow) rating on the tire sidewall (which denotes a deep tread to help move water/snow aside). If you're willing to limit yourself to just the options available at these sites, look at some of the tire reviews from Consumer Reports and at tirerack.com. You may also want to find a Sienna owner's group and ask for suggestions there.

Q: How to replace passenger side mirror on 2004 Toyota Sienna?
I need procedure on how to replace passenger side mirror on 2004 Toyota Sienna

A: You don't need to remove the door panel to replace the mirror. Start by opening the door and locate a triangular shape panel cover to the mirror. Pop the cover off and you will see 3 bolts/screws/nuts holding the mirror onto the door. The bolts are attached to the mirror so you'll want to remove the nuts, unclip the wiring connector and pull it away from the door. Make sure you've got a hand on the mirror before completely removing the last nut because it can fall out and hit your door panel.

Q: Honda Odyssey over Toyota Sienna and why?
Narrowed my search down to these two minivans. If you own one or did, what is your experience with it and why is it better than the toyota sienna? thanks. Thanks for all the great answers, what year models are these? If you can please list the year when you answer that would help me out....as I am probably getting a pre-owned, 05-07.

A: Consumer Reports on both of them have them as RECOMMENDED USED CAR buys. The Sienna was a little better rated than the Odyssey in the 00-03 range, they seem about equal 04-07. I'd check autos.msn.com for their ratings and edmunds.com for consumer feedback to see if there are any common issues arising from each model. All things being equal in the ratings, it will probably come down to the OWNER of the vehicle - I look for a single owner that has been giving the van all the TLC that you would. BIG PLUSES TO LOOK FOR: garage kept, no stains, clean and original floor mats (means they kept them vaccuumed and washed which indicates care of the rest of the vehicle), synthetic oil and fluids (lowest wear AND further indicates they cared enough to spend the extra money) and lots of receipts to proving its maintenance (shows you the regular oil changes and all other maintenance it properly up to date). With these in mind, it is usually best to find one from the individual to guage the TLC. 2nd best option is a certified used from the dealer that has all the records but only pay the private party value and not the inflated retail price.

Q: Where can I buy a Rear Center Seat for a Toyota Sienna minivan?
The rear center seat goes between the two seats that are located directly behind the driver and the passenger. The rear center seat made the Sienna an 8 passenger vehicle. 2004 -2008

A: I don't think you will be able to add the center seat to a 7 passenger Sienna minivan. The 8 passenger has a different floor layout where the seat attachments fasten to lock the seats in place. Though it's easy to think you're looking for a seat to put in the center row... this center seat on a 8 passenger Sienna has no arm rest and folds flat with a cup holder built into the back. The fact that it has different floor mount points will be the biggest determining factor that would allow it to be moved forward almost in between the front seats for easier access.
